Answer to Question 1

ANSWER: The list of recommendations includes tougher standards for graduation; more courses in science, math, foreign language, and technology; a longer school day and school year; more homework; higher expectations for student achievement; and others as outlined in the chapter.

Answer to Question 2

ANSWER: Critics were calling for educational accountability, and a number of reports invoked statistics to document the decline of American education. These included information about achievement test scores, international comparisons of student achievement, and illiteracy rates.
